Any of them may need medical attention as the weather changes. This is NOT always the case, but the possibility does exist as they are not well adapted to changes involving HEAT of Arizona or any state. They MUST MUST MUST be in evaporative coolers or air-conditioning.
This is not optional for them to live outside without either of these no matter what you may have read. Without medical issues, this many bunnies will thrive on about $150.00 per month for the cost of Timothy Hay. Any exotic vet can verify this for them to have optimal health.
